Output ba8a31f36d31d524793feea75f695693dafcab00f911b2576712b75101c262fb:6

value
4160189358
script pubkey
OP_0 OP_PUSHBYTES_20 e431ea72f1dc1ab88d59a5356a677ece8084ec76
address
bc1qusc75uh3msdt3r2e556k5em7e6qgfmrk3rzwqn
transaction
ba8a31f36d31d524793feea75f695693dafcab00f911b2576712b75101c262fb